2007 Toyota Camry vs. 2012 Toyota Corolla
To start off, 2012 Toyota Corolla is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Toyota Camry.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Toyota Camry would be higher. At 2,399 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Toyota Camry is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Toyota Camry (147 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 15 more horse power than 2012 Toyota Corolla. (132 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Toyota Camry should accelerate faster than 2012 Toyota Corolla.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Toyota Camry (187 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 14 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Toyota Corolla. (173 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2007 Toyota Camry will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Toyota Corolla.
Compare all specifications:
2007 Toyota Camry | 2012 Toyota Corolla | |
Make | Toyota | Toyota |
Model | Camry | Corolla |
Year Released | 2007 | 2012 |
Body Type | Sedan |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2399 cc | 1800 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 147 HP | 132 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 187 Nm | 173 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4400 RPM | 4400 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line / Electric Hybrid |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4810 mm | 4572 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1830 mm | 1763 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1470 mm | 1466 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2780 mm | 2601 mm |
